What Are The Penalties For Home Invasion In Michigan?
WebSecond-Degree is a felony punishable by up to 15 years in prison and a fine of up to $3,000. Third-Degree is a felony punishable by up to 5 years in prison and a fine of … WebUnder Michigan law (MCL 750.110a (4)) Home invasion in the third degree is a felony with a maximum punishment of 5 years or a fine up to $2,000.00, or both.
